Ecco Shoes

45 Brompton Road SW31DE London , London, United Kingdom United Kingdom
  • Profile: Ecco Shoes is a Footwear company located at London , London,, United Kingdom United Kingdom, address is 45 Brompton Road, London , London, SW31DE UK, postcode is SW31DE, you can contact Ecco Shoes by phone 442075845737
Please share as much information as you can about Ecco Shoes so other users can benefit from your comment.